  1. 1. If you saw a swallow flying high it is the sign of fine weather
    2. When the swallows fly low it is a sign of bad weather
    3. If you saw a cat sitting at the fire with his tail turned towards it
    4. When you hear a dog crying it is a sign that some friend is going to die
    5. If a hen comes into the kitchen with a sop of say hanging on to her it is a sign that a friend was coming to the house.
    6. When two hens fight in the yard it is a sign of a visitor of great importance such as a priest or a civic-guard or some other important person
    7. When the cock crows at an unusual hour it is a sign that somebody in the parish is going to die. When he crows three times it is a sign that a relative is going to die.
    Collected by Tom Kiely
    Streamhill
    Aherlow
